LDAP-backed IAM lookups built a search filter using the request access key before signature verification, allowing filter metacharacters to alter query semantics. This made account lookup behavior observable and could be abused as a pre-authentication oracle in affected LDAP deployments. This change escapes access key values with ldap.EscapeFilter when constructing LDAP search filters and adds a regression test that verifies metacharacters are encoded rather than interpreted as filter operators. Also add DN escaping along with this fix too. Reported by GitHub user KrisKennawayDD.
